Subsidized HVAC tune-up service for Entergy Louisiana residential customers to improve air conditioner efficiency, reduce energy costs, and extend equipment life. Service includes cleaning, inspection, and minor adjustments.

Discounted tune-up service saves approximately $90 vs. market rate

Key Details

  • Professional AC tune-up for only $60
  • Available to all Entergy Louisiana customers
  • Includes cleaning, inspection, and adjustments
  • Improves efficiency and extends equipment life
  • Seasonal program, check website for availability
